How much does it cost to rent an apartment in 96001?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| 96001 Studio Apartments | $2,181 | $825 | $4,895 |
| 96001 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,218 | $1,050 | $1,395 |
| 96001 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,324 | $1,100 | $2,200 |
| 96001 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,631 | $1,085 | $2,195 |
| 96001 4 Bedroom Apartments | $988 | $918 | $1,059 |
